Look again. I think you are confusing "hands free dialing" and bluetooth.

Hands free dialing is part of OnStar telephone service starting on page 2-47. You can push the OnStar button and talk to customer service with no account.

I'm pretty sure that while bluetooth is in the OnStar box it does not need activating. Bluetooth is phone only/no audio profile. Not all phones are compatible, seem to recall it doesn't like Apples.
